Burnley heads into the 2017-2018 season with optimism, as they are coming off a very successful season a year ago, as they survived in the Premier League for the first time in club history. They may have a difficult time staying up again but they can take heart from what Bournemouth has done, as they not only stayed up, but cracked the top ten. The top half of the table is definitely too optimistic for Burnley but they do have enough talent to avoid relegation for the second straight season, but only if everything goes well. Oddsmakers are not really sure if Burnley is going to survive, as they set the odds on relegation near a pick and the point total for Burnley this season was set at 34.5.

Burnley has no chance to win the Premier League so the focus is on whether or not they will be relegated. The Clarets finished with 40 points last season, six clear of the relegation zone. They thrived at home, as they were 10-6 at home with three draws. It may be difficult to duplicate that home success in 2017-2018, so the team will need to play better away from home where they picked up just one win.

Burnley scored the fewest goals of any teams that survived last season in the Premier League with 39, but they allowed fewer goals than any team in the bottom half of the league, as they allowed just 55 goals.

Burnley gets a chance to play in the FA Cup and in the EFL Cup this season, as they survived to stay in the Premier League. Last year’s 16th place finish was the best-ever for Burnley in the Premier League and it puts them into the Premier League for consecutive seasons for the first time in their history.

What's New?

The Clarets added Jon Walters from Stoke, Charlie Taylor from Leeds and Jack Cork and Phil Bardsley from Swansea. Cork and Walters are veterans who have played more than 400 games between them. Cork should be a good signing, as he figures to start in the midfield and Walters should also see a lot of playing time.

What's Gone?

The Clarets lost Michael Keane who went to Everton. They also released Joey Barton, let George Boyd go to Sheffield and Paul Robinson retired. The big loss is Keane who was sold to Everton for £25 million. His loss leaves a major hole on defense. The losses of Boyd and Barton also don’t help, but Keane is the man who will be tough to replace.

Burnley 2017-18 Predictions

Burnley surprised a lot of people last season but they won’t go unnoticed this time around. Head coach Sean Dyche said recently that his team is still adjusting to the Premier League. “I still think we need that extra bit of experience within the group.  I thought we needed that all along, even though this will be my third Premier League season.”

Dyche is smart enough to realize that his team is probably in for a relegation fight this season. They simply don’t score enough goals to get any easy wins. Their tandem of Andre Gray and Sam Vokes combined to score 19 goals last season.  Burnley played really good defense last season and that meant they could win games 1-0 or 2-1, especially at home. That may not happen this season, especially with Keane now in Everton. It will also be very difficult for Burnley to repeat what they did at home, where they got 33 of their 40 points.

I think there may be some value on taking Burnley to get relegated at odds of +126.  Oddsmakers are telling us right from the start that Burnley is going to struggle, as they set the point’s total at 34.5. Last year it was Hull getting relegated with 34 points, so Burnley is expected to be right on the cut line for the 2017-2018 season.
